QQ登录

只需一步,快速开始

登录 | 注册 | 找回密码

三维网

 找回密码
 注册

QQ登录

只需一步,快速开始

展开

通知     

查看: 4704|回复: 44
收起左侧

[求助] 刀長測量問題

[复制链接]
发表于 2015-12-17 22:05:15 | 显示全部楼层 |阅读模式 来自: 中国台湾

马上注册,结识高手,享用更多资源,轻松玩转三维网社区。

您需要 登录 才可以下载或查看,没有帐号?注册

x
我目前是用 50MM 的Z軸設定器來測量刀具長度.......
" L% `! k" `# d/ t
; o& i  @8 n0 ^5 _* K然後將機械座標的值,手動輸入刀號的刀長補正那兒...然後在刀長磨耗中輸入50....這是總刀長+ j; [# |) U4 K. {$ k6 v

) I& k8 @! R/ c4 j但是用手動輸入有時不小心會輸入錯誤.......
9 H7 X6 X- W9 b% _& {3 L+ `8 {$ t, F  u+ K( p& e
所以現在想用FANUC 0IMD 先將相對座標歸零 然後將刀具長度 按Z =>Z輸入來自動輸入刀長補正值...3 o8 |! u6 x& u* m; ^5 p, z: y2 |
: g/ |/ n" r' C1 f, N/ {
可是這樣做磨耗會自動被歸零...又要手動輸入50.....這樣超麻煩& G/ g1 H- H2 {6 L8 a

2 i$ o9 t8 p# p2 U# C請教:" B* T% }$ L2 A8 n, u
9 r5 k5 R- f1 O9 E
1.有哪裡可以輸入刀長會自動+50 的方法.....! @2 @( K/ E, d4 ?* g

0 }( ]) I1 `$ J$ W0 LG54的Z那裏就不用說了,那是我輸入工件高度的地方: t2 o) \1 J' v* o& j0 ]/ g. W

3 I: \$ ?5 Q8 e9 m: o* E( A9 }G54上面那個也可以我已經知道了...但那裏有時是設置偏移植的地方
# U# s2 h4 \/ p; d0 W# q
+ b9 X0 ]: Q) b7 L8 A/ z還有其他地方嗎?* z" [2 \. o4 n' |2 [3 Y

$ D! o" ]1 Y! z2 m2. 還是有誰會寫MACRO來自動輸入刀長,當然也要自動加入Z軸射定器的高度...如:T1就用H1.........
/ T- X9 v1 x7 {4 f! k) S) I' K0 e. ]/ _
會的人可以教一下嗎?* f6 G$ d% L9 W5 I* E4 P
+ f# c4 h: `0 u+ r% L! {
謝謝.............
* P* B' r0 l- [1 H7 b3 L
% ]6 n2 }1 U! c2 @: s, S7 O: t* b" _( I5 r5 m7 O8 K
发表于 2015-12-18 10:59:05 | 显示全部楼层 来自: 中国台湾
機械廠沒給程式嗎,M111那個
: Y; e2 v7 k3 r$ o: E" Q
发表于 2015-12-18 11:37:35 | 显示全部楼层 来自: 中国广东东莞
在刀具库那的刀具磨损输入补正50
发表于 2015-12-18 11:44:40 | 显示全部楼层 来自: 中国台湾
MACRO-515改-50MM
& J2 F; B  {! R  @. M3 N* a指令 M111 S2 H(刀號)/ m! F( T1 L1 Q6 i9 m- q
基本上是廠商給的,本人不會改
# u+ W" A1 J2 s( b) P+ e0 g) _使用請小心打錯數字會回饋MACRO,問一下廠商使用方法教好
. I; v2 @4 ?2 O, N( M使用機器FANUC 0IMD
! H6 h3 [8 [1 d* V' j
发表于 2015-12-18 11:51:41 | 显示全部楼层 来自: 中国台湾
忘了說量刀Z時會退原點,測試時請切慢一點; Z2 c8 m* P6 ~7 B, k" i
 楼主| 发表于 2015-12-18 12:33:44 | 显示全部楼层 来自: 中国台湾台中市
GP88 发表于 2015-12-18 11:37
9 J# |/ \, _3 u在刀具库那的刀具磨损输入补正50
% v0 X6 I" v3 \2 ~
謝謝..我原本就是在那兒輸入的
发表于 2015-12-18 15:06:26 | 显示全部楼层 来自: 中国江苏无锡
用宏可以实现
4 m  u& i5 C8 R8 ^7 N2 m
 楼主| 发表于 2015-12-18 15:14:08 | 显示全部楼层 来自: 中国台湾台中市
lyd_2005 发表于 2015-12-18 15:06
5 {. Y" Z+ o2 g! A/ A/ W2 u用宏可以实现

6 ], ], F! k6 R9 I, [1 e* @怎麼弄...可以幫寫一下宏嗎?
 楼主| 发表于 2015-12-18 15:14:53 | 显示全部楼层 来自: 中国台湾台中市
宏怎麼弄我不懂啊?$ v+ ]! l+ \6 t3 S
发表于 2015-12-18 15:20:57 | 显示全部楼层 来自: 中国江苏无锡
具体如下:
6 q7 T! `+ I& F7 [O6666(G6)" B8 S( U" H5 j1 ~  x+ t
#510=#999                                      (在O9001换刀子程序中M99前加上#999=#4120,记忆刀号)
/ ^. e7 ~( Q+ m) h. w5 U1 |6 b6 g) rG0G91G28Z0.   ~3 `' `! [& [, q6 o3 P: u
M98P8896                                      (对刀点位置)& }+ `8 W. h5 \! S8 z- E: o2 m
#[10000+#510]=0                             (刀长清零)
  ~3 I: F% C& p( L& a#[11000+#510]=50 .                        (刀长磨耗设置50.)3 P1 A3 c7 s% s, A% V5 P4 {
Z#511
, \% h0 g( |8 O1 \+ t3 GG1Z[#511-50]F3000
  C/ P# E. Z5 ^. |/ }0 GM00(HAND MOVE Z)                       (手动对刀)
8 q. f: F) \6 h, ^#[11000+#510]=#5023(SET Z L#)    (设置刀长)
7 c/ i) D$ C' E; l! h$ z$ A# IG4P200- H! I! E) p" L7 e: T& P* s
G0G91G28Z0.M5 # L* |7 k  X+ M/ g) p% c$ K) T
M99 " A- K+ U1 J6 ~4 u3 m/ \* G
O8896(DUI DAO SUB)
# r9 @  G0 K) N6 C( L! n2 }G90G53G0X680.Y-307.Z0 $ V! H2 d. o: ~, X, ~2 f
#511=-250.(-) ! s7 }$ J- D% Z! R
M99
0 @5 r. c. I  s  S. X& W6 GMDI下对刀' `3 T- G2 t; K
T1M6
( s! d' A" s* N! j- s+ \M98P6666+ N' y% m; X% v8 ?
中途需手动移动Z轴到对刀仪0值,MDI在启动,会在H1刀补,自动写上Z机械坐标    -********     及50.
# G7 e& n  M+ @5 N6 u
发表于 2015-12-18 15:25:45 | 显示全部楼层 来自: 中国江苏无锡
或用代码控制G6,需将6666改9010: x% T7 t1 [! p
参数6050改67 w3 ?+ t3 G6 c- N5 q1 N2 ?
可直接在MDI下G6指令对刀
 楼主| 发表于 2015-12-18 15:40:04 | 显示全部楼层 来自: 中国台湾台中市
我把 O6666(G6) O8896都存到機台中
$ ?& \- h- Q+ O+ [6 Q; v) e$ F5 u1 Z; _: ?& }2 b
然後在MDI模式下執行
$ W: z7 \6 ?& o. c  H' fT1M63 ]) R* o) L* g7 P( ~# E9 c& G) S
M98P66664
* \) P" m, P( C  j# @! ]
0 F) K$ n" K6 M1 e  V手動把刀移到Z軸設定器到對刀儀09 f) R& \3 N; N
* h5 C! o" T6 T: O9 p6 L$ z
在按執行  ...就會自動輸入是嗎/ s# l+ k; x; B% l" R4 _8 ?) _
 楼主| 发表于 2015-12-18 15:43:51 | 显示全部楼层 来自: 中国台湾台中市
lyd_2005 发表于 2015-12-18 15:25
* O+ A& ]) l( N6 N. w或用代码控制G6,需将6666改9010
$ f& M1 ~! ]( c' p& F2 _6 w% O% V, [% X; ~. h参数6050改6: V. f# F0 K- s+ |: Z, t
可直接在MDI下G6指令对刀
2 ?& p6 N( I) k2 x  _' {! V
這個我不懂....( G: G. z: ~' W0 P8 M
发表于 2015-12-18 16:40:28 | 显示全部楼层 来自: 中国江苏无锡
gopc 发表于 2015-12-18 15:40
9 z" n* ]' S, z4 w我把 O6666(G6) O8896都存到機台中
. t# q( E9 b/ T4 ^$ h7 C* y; p0 @/ f% B2 O3 s, T2 }! e: \5 |, |
然後在MDI模式下執行
/ [. T+ P2 R" i  T9 t; k6 i
是的 刀长  和50.两个数据
发表于 2015-12-18 16:45:22 | 显示全部楼层 来自: 中国江苏无锡
本帖最后由 lyd_2005 于 2015-12-18 16:46 编辑
( h: n1 f* i7 G, n% k1 {1 s% ~6 M5 g; M' R1 i' o2 ~6 N$ o
用M98P6666的话( E  `7 S/ l/ S: R' E! X! T$ R
O6666的M99改M30/ r4 r  w% C; |% H8 F
 楼主| 发表于 2015-12-18 19:24:24 | 显示全部楼层 来自: 中国台湾台中市
lyd_2005 发表于 2015-12-18 16:40
$ o* F6 h6 G" X9 `7 Y2 J是的 刀长  和50.两个数据
. v  o0 w, K3 z9 O) U/ j
試了...可以移動到我要的位置...: K9 }9 {& H* @3 ~# s* @- {
+ }* e- n9 {( c3 P1 l8 H& [/ N
但是變量號超限....8 y4 p/ T7 l% @7 I7 v: X. b
发表于 2015-12-18 21:35:24 | 显示全部楼层 来自: 中国浙江嘉兴
gopc 发表于 2015-12-18 19:249 l* _2 I* c" v( r0 [
試了...可以移動到我要的位置...
. b5 T" a. Z; {1 A/ B9 u2 ?" [: G/ Q" u2 m
但是變量號超限....
5 |# T8 K+ N  a5 m+ T9 S
先检查#999和#510两个值是否相等,不等的话改   O9001
发表于 2015-12-18 21:39:55 | 显示全部楼层 来自: 中国浙江嘉兴
刀补画面是否如下四列
0 l+ o6 s% D3 X刀长形状                      刀长磨秏                      刀具形状             刀具磨耗
发表于 2015-12-18 21:44:20 | 显示全部楼层 来自: 中国台湾
直接在EXT的Z軸輸入-50就可以了,直接對應所有刀長補正
发表于 2015-12-18 21:55:08 | 显示全部楼层 来自: 中国江苏无锡
lyd_2005 发表于 2015-12-18 15:20
# K; u$ a- x0 x5 ^/ }4 D% |具体如下:, h8 x0 s2 p+ b$ i- `9 Z- _8 o9 I& a
O6666(G6)' _" `" N2 h; g& I/ g
#510=#999                                      (在O9001换刀子程序中M99前加上 ...
/ _. b( z& R2 X! i% f7 s6 B
在不知道机床行程等状态下,Z#511和G1Z[#511-50]F3000 是不是很危险?这可是在G90状态。
 楼主| 发表于 2015-12-18 22:28:06 | 显示全部楼层 来自: 中国台湾
本帖最后由 gopc 于 2015-12-19 09:00 编辑
/ e* N0 O# @" ?% q: c- p, G4 A5 h' p% [, Z0 {
請教 在O9001换刀子程序中M99前加上#999=#4120$ Q# ?( k& Z5 s1 ]
我是還要編輯 O9001  在M99前加上#999=#4120 這段是嗎?6 L" E+ Q+ x, p% v

2 c* g8 s5 x" l$ x( G. i. v, T9 \" ~% q' ^4 z4 A" a" K' O

6 n9 k3 R$ i7 }) t' j" W, d+ ?3 r  Q% x& N3 [9 [! S
還有請教#[10000+#510] 和 #[11000+#510]中的10000跟11000是甚麼意思?/ N" A/ r1 r/ o: }9 `
8 n% O& i8 y9 R

' y  k# i9 W- h! x- T
发表于 2015-12-19 10:54:05 | 显示全部楼层 来自: 中国江苏无锡
gopc 发表于 2015-12-18 22:287 B& I# j1 @4 |/ x& u
請教 在O9001换刀子程序中M99前加上#999=#4120
7 i$ V% M; E' H1 |  H我是還要編輯 O9001  在M99前加上#999=#4120 這段是嗎?
) u* R* \* n3 ^. i, P
1.是編輯 O9001  2 `- n; ]% b1 g: m
2.#[10000+#510] 和 #[11000+#510]对应  刀长形状                      刀长磨秏  ; x- i/ x. e8 l" N
3. Z#511自行设置Z轴对刀安全高度
发表于 2015-12-19 10:55:04 | 显示全部楼层 来自: 中国江苏无锡
AUTOCADR41 发表于 2015-12-18 21:55
2 h! ?! `* z/ ]( d在不知道机床行程等状态下,Z#511和G1Z[#511-50]F3000 是不是很危险?这可是在G90状态。

4 g, x7 [3 j4 N这是我们公司机器,其他自行调整
 楼主| 发表于 2015-12-19 12:10:08 | 显示全部楼层 来自: 中国台湾
lyd_2005 发表于 2015-12-19 10:54
! Y0 N' O% G& P+ q% _1.是編輯 O9001  
! H: M- P% x% [2.#[10000+#510] 和 #[11000+#510]对应  刀长形状                      刀长磨秏  
4 x+ e; z' d" V8 R8 k; Y9 E ...

% j( x. o) e5 T: @/ j在請教那如果我不要刀子自動跑到定點在手動...因為放Z軸設定器的地方不一定
; C1 ?" J# f2 O) D- [  [( i
7 ?5 T7 @& A; ^6 y4 U. I6 ]是不是可以去掉這些
2 O3 l8 @- x; T& G+ z3 {
  1. M98P8896     
    9 S, |+ i* q! P8 D# e" ?7 ^
  2. Z#511) x0 f/ |9 k# T4 X( ~: Y7 L
  3. G1Z[#511-50]F3000
复制代码

- g: Z! j) w* V# i+ J6 G1 y+ }
我直接移動Z軸到對刀儀0值就好了
发表于 2015-12-19 12:31:02 | 显示全部楼层 来自: 中国江苏无锡
gopc 发表于 2015-12-19 12:10; l; m+ n; v0 a) h0 o& j% [8 k
在請教那如果我不要刀子自動跑到定點在手動...因為放Z軸設定器的地方不一定
8 N/ H- ?7 [1 \8 `) K- d) |1 ?% E0 I2 c  Y
是不是可以去掉這些

" T" S* ?. I) s: Z- I, @可以去掉這些的
发表回复
您需要登录后才可以回帖 登录 | 注册

本版积分规则


Licensed Copyright © 2016-2020 http://www.3dportal.cn/ All Rights Reserved 京 ICP备13008828号

小黑屋|手机版|Archiver|三维网 ( 京ICP备2023026364号-1 )

快速回复 返回顶部 返回列表